§ 16-1006 — Contributions by city; amount; how credited; interest; when

Nebraska·Ch. 16 Cities of the First Class
Each city of the first class shall contribute to the retirement system a sum equal to one hundred percent of the amounts deducted, in accordance with subsection (1) of section 16-1005 , from each such police officer's periodic salary. Such payment shall be contributed as provided in subsection (1) of section 16-1005 for employee contributions and shall be credited to the police officer's employer account on a monthly basis. Each such account shall also be credited with regular interest.
